Subject:   Compiling Pose 3.3 Under FreeBSD 4.2 
Message-ID:  <OF94B5669B.ED911DAB-ON85256AEE.00607846@ko.com>

next in thread | raw e-mail | index | archive | help
I'm trying to get a PalmOS dev environment set up on FreeBSD, and as a
first step, would like to get Pose working.  Everytime I use the
installed Pose package (I think it's Pose 3.1) I get a segfault when I
load the ROM.  So I try to compile Pose 3.3 from src and I get this
error message:

checking for 'in fl_height (void)' in -fltk... no
FLTK must be installed before running configure

FLTK is installed, first ver 1.0.9 then 1.0.10.  I made a simlink to
libfltk.a in /usr/lib which is where the -Building.txt said it should
be, and my directory for fltk is "FL", which is what the _Building.txt
said it should be.

So, what is configure looking for, and what can I do to correct this.
